Please if somebody can help as I am using a 4K TV but the Peppy Screen is not covering the entire screen and even if I am selecting any resolution from the options, I end up having the same as shown in the image

https://i.imgur.com/rUxtlDN.jpeg

Please advise if do I need to do a fresh installation or if I need to make some changes in the existing files/folder.

@ rajiv.kumar1984
Try to do this:

  1. Connect via FTP
  2. go to - boot / userconfig.txt
    3.Add:
    hdmi_group = 2
    hdmi_mode = 87
    hdmi_cvt 1920 1080 60 3 0 0 0
    hdmi_drive = 2
